No smoking allowed!March 29, 2004Ireland became the first country to institute a ban on smoking in workplaces, under the Public Health (Tobacco) Act. The ban is strictly enforced and includes bars, restaurants, clubs, offices, public buildings, company cars, trucks, taxis and vans. Violations attract a maximum €3,000 fine, while a prison sentence can also be given at a later time.

Thomas Cranmer consecrated as Archbishop of CanterburyMarch 30, 1533Archbishop Cranmer was a leader of the English Reformation and is best remembered for his role in allowing Henry VIII’s divorce from Catherine of Aragon, which resulted in the separation of the English Church from the Catholic Church. Cranmer also wrote and compiled the first two editions of the Book of Common Prayer, still used today by the Anglican Church.

Eiffel Tower officially opensMarch 31, 1889Located on the Champ de Mars in Paris, France, the Eiffel Tower was originally built as the entrance arch for the World’s Fair in 1889. It is named after Gustave Eiffel, whose company was in charge of the project. More than 200,000,000 people have visited the tower since its construction, making it the most-visited paid monument in the world.

Don’t be an April fool!April 1No one is absolutely clear on the date of its origin, but the earliest recorded association between April 1 and foolishness can be found in Chaucer’s Canterbury Tales (1392). April Fools’ Day or All Fools’ Day, as it is sometimes called, gives pranksters a free pass to bust out their best tricks and practical jokes. Don’t be caught off-guard!
